The root word in decision is "decide". The prefix in decision is "de-" meaning "off" or "away". The suffix in decision is "-ion" which forms a noun indicating an action or process.
The root word in "judicious" is "judice," which comes from the Latin word "judicium," meaning judgment or decision.
The root word for "undecided" is "decide," which comes from the Latin word "decidere," meaning to cut off or determine. In this case, the prefix "un-" is added to indicate the opposite of being determined or settled on a decision.
